  • Source

    Detergent Human ADIPOR1 Protein, Flag,His Tag (AD1-H55D3) is expressed from Baculovirus-Insect cells. It contains AA Glu 89 - Leu 375 (Accession # Q96A54).

    Predicted N-terminus: Asp

    Request for sequence
  • Molecular Characterization

    ADIPOR1 Structure

    Other Tags and Version Biotin & Other Labeled Version

    This protein carries a flag tag at the N-terminus and a polyhistidine tag at the C-terminus.

    The protein has a calculated MW of 36.8 kDa.

Performance Data

  • Bioactivity-ELISA

     ADIPOR1 ELISA

    Immobilized Human ADIPOR1 Protein, Flag,His Tag (Cat. No. AD1-H55D3) at 1 μg/mL (100 μL/well) can bind Anti-ADIPOR1 Antibody, Rabbit IgG1 with a linear range of 0.2-5 ng/mL (QC tested).

    Protocol
  • Bioactivity-SPR

     ADIPOR1 SPR

    Human AdipoR1 Antibody captured on Protein G Chip can bind Human ADIPOR1 Protein, Flag, His Tag (Cat. No. AD1-H55D3) with an affinity constant of 84.3 nM as determined in a SPR assay (in presence of DDM and CHS) (Biacore 8K) (Routinely tested).

Background

Adiponectin Receptor 1 (AdipoR1) is a pivotal receptor mediating the metabolic effects of the adipokine adiponectin. AdipoR1 features seven transmembrane domains with an intracellular N-terminus and an extracellular C-terminus responsible for adiponectin binding. AdipoR1 is predominantly expressed in skeletal muscle and can activate adenosine monophosphate-activated protein kinase (AMPK). This activation leads to the phosphorylation of ACC and the subsequent upregulation of CPT-1A, which together critically enhance mitochondrial fatty acid β-oxidation. Dysfunction in this AdipoR1-driven pathway is closely associated with impaired fatty acid oxidation and dyslipidemia. AdipoR1 represents a significant therapeutic target for metabolic disorders involving lipid dysregulation.
